      Add a filter_init function to the filters so that a filter can execute · a205c87a
      Justin Erenkrantz authored
      arbitrary code before the handlers are invoked.
      
      This resolves an issue with incorrect 304s on If-Modified-Since mod_include
      requests since ap_meets_conditions() is not aware that this is a dynamic
      request and it is not possible to satisfy 304 for these requests (unless
      xbithack full is on, of course).  When mod_include runs as a filter, it is
      too late to set any flag since the handler is responsible for calling
      ap_meets_conditions(), which it should do before generating any data.
      
      If a module doesn't need to run such arbitrary code, it can just pass NULL
      as the argument and all is well.

        These emits occur mainline, outside of the pphrase_callback, so we never
        opened readtty or writetty.  But they are absolute failures, nothing the
        user could do to deal with them.  They are logged in the ssl vhost's error
        log.
      
        In this case, I forgot my SSLCertificateKeyFile, so the server never
        tried the callback.  writetty wasn't initialized, so we segfaulted.
      
        This segfault is due to misconfig, not to the dialog with the user.
        This is the easiest fix (easier to read, too), but we shouldn't need
        to worry too much that the release is tagged.  If we retag, fine, then
        grab it, but it only addresses a config problem.
